Как в Excel сделать формулу, если больше: полное руководство

Работа с большими массивами данных в электронных таблицах часто требует автоматизации принятия решений на основе числовых значений. Самым распространенным сценарием является проверка условия: превышает ли текущее число определенный порог. В программе Microsoft Excel для решения этой задачи используется мощная логическая функция ЕСЛИ в связке с оператором сравнения «больше». Понимание принципа работы этой конструкции открывает двери к созданию сложных отчетов и умных калькуляторов.

Суть операции сводится к тому, что программа сравнивает две величины и выдает один из двух результатов в зависимости от того, истинно или ложно полученное утверждение. Если число в ячейке действительно больше эталонного значения, пользователь получает положительный ответ или выполняет расчет по первой ветке. В противном случае, когда значение меньше или равно порогу, срабатывает альтернативный сценарий. Это базовый механизм булевой логики, лежащий в основе большинства алгоритмов обработки данных.

В данной статье мы детально разберем синтаксис, разберем типичные ошибки и рассмотрим продвинутые примеры использования условного форматирования и вложенных функций. Вы научитесь не просто писать код, но и строить гибкие системы анализа данных, которые будут реагировать на изменения чисел в реальном времени. Правильное использование логических операторов значительно ускоряет работу аналитика и минимизирует риск человеческой ошибки при ручной проверке списков.

Синтаксис и структура логической функции

Фундаментом для построения любого условия в Excel является правильное понимание аргументов функции ЕСЛИ. Она требует указания трех ключевых параметров: самого условия, значения при истине и значения при лозии. Без хотя бы одного из этих компонентов формула работать не будет или выдаст ошибку синтаксиса. Важно строго соблюдать порядок следования аргументов и разделять их разделителями, принятыми в вашей региональной версии программы.

В русскоязычной версии Excel формула записывается с использованием точки с запятой как разделителя аргументов, тогда как в английской версии используется запятая. Это критически важный нюанс, так как использование неправильного разделителя приведет к появлению сообщения об ошибке вместо ожидаемого результата. Логическое выражение «больше» задается специальным символом, который должен быть заключен в кавычки, если он является частью текстовой строки, или писаться без них при работе с числами.

Рассмотрим базовую структуру команды, которая проверяет, превышает ли число в ячейке A1 значение 100. Если это так, система напишет «Превышено», если нет — «Норма». Код будет выглядеть следующим образом:

=ЕСЛИ(A1>100; "Превышено"; "Норма")

Здесь A1>100 является логическим выражением, возвращающим ИСТИНА или ЛОЖЬ. Аргументы «Превышено» и «Норма» являются возвращаемыми значениями. Обратите внимание, что текстовые строки обязательно должны быть заключены в двойные кавычки. Если вы планируете возвращать числовые значения или результаты других вычислений, кавычки не нужны. Нарушение этого правила — одна из самых частых причин появления ошибки #ЗНАЧ! в таблицах пользователей.

⚠️ Внимание: В некоторых региональных настройках Excel разделителем аргументов может выступать запятая, а не точка с запятой. Если формула не работает, проверьте системные настройки или попробуйте заменить разделитель.

Операторы сравнения и их применение

Для создания условий недостаточно только функции ЕСЛИ, необходимо грамотно использовать операторы сравнения. Символ «больше» (>) является одним из шести основных логических операторов, доступных в Excel. Понимание различий между ними позволяет строить более точные фильтры и условия. Часто пользователи путают строгое неравенство с нестрогим, что приводит к некорректной обработке граничных значений.

Когда вы пишете условие A1>10, программа игнорирует значение 10, реагируя только на числа 10.00001 и выше. Если же ваша задача включает в себя и само пороговое значение, необходимо использовать составной оператор «больше или равно» (>=). Эта тонкость особенно важна при расчете бонусов, налоговых ставок или скидок, где каждый единица может иметь финансовое значение.

📊 Какой оператор вы используете чаще всего?
Только «больше» (>)
«Больше или равно» (>=)
Равно (=)
Не равно (<>)

Помимо числовых значений, эти операторы отлично работают с датами, так как в Excel даты хранятся как последовательные числа. Это позволяет легко определять, наступила ли дата дедлайна или она уже в прошлом. Также возможно сравнение текстовых строк, где оператор «больше» оценивает алфавитный порядок символов, что может быть полезно при сортировке списков по второму критерию.

Ниже приведена таблица основных операторов сравнения с примерами их поведения при значении в ячейке A1, равном 50:

Оператор Описание Пример условия Результат для 50
> Больше A1>50 ЛОЖЬ
>= Больше или равно A1>=50 ИСТИНА
< Меньше A1<50 ЛОЖЬ
<= Меньше или равно A1<=50 ИСТИНА

Практические примеры использования в бизнесе

Теоретические знания становятся полезными только тогда, когда они применяются к реальным задачам. В финансовой отчетности часто требуется выделять расходы, превышающие бюджет, или продажи, которые выше плана. Автоматизация таких проверок позволяет мгновенно видеть проблемные зоны без необходимости вручную просматриивать тысячи строк данных. Это экономит часы работы и снижает когнитивную нагрузку на сотрудника.

Представим ситуацию, где менеджеру по продажам начисляется премия, только если его выручка строго больше 1 миллиона рублей. Если сумма меньше или равна миллиону, премия составляет ноль. Формула для ячейки с расчетом премии будет выглядеть так: =ЕСЛИ(B2>1000000; B2*0.1; 0). Здесь мы не просто выводим текст, а сразу производим расчет 10% от суммы продаж.

Другой распространенный кейс — управление запасами на складе. Необходимо подсветить или отметить товары, остаток которых стал меньше минимально допустимого уровня. Хотя здесь используется оператор «меньше», логика остается зеркальной. Однако, если мы хотим найти товары-лидеры, мы снова вернемся к условию «больше среднего». Для этого можно использовать функцию СРЗНАЧ прямо внутри условия.

☑️ Проверка перед запуском формулы

Выполнено: 0 / 4

Использование абсолютных ссылок позволяет фиксировать пороговое значение в отдельной ячейке, что делает таблицу более гибкой. Вы можете менять план продаж в одной ячейке, и все формулы автоматически пересчитаются. Это профессиональный подход к моделированию данных, который отличает продвинутых пользователей от новичков.

Обработка ошибок и текстовых значений

При работе с реальными данными часто возникает ситуация, когда в ячейке, которая должна содержать число, оказывается текст или ошибка. Если вы попытаетесь сравнить текст с числом, Excel может выдать unexpected результат или ошибку #ЗНАЧ!. Например, сравнение строки "100 руб" с числом 50 приведет к ошибке, так как программа не может математически обработать текст с валютой без предварительной очистки.

Для защиты формулы от сбоев рекомендуется использовать функцию ЕЧИСЛО в связке с ЕСЛИ. Это позволяет сначала проверить тип данных, и только потом проводить сравнение. Если в ячейке не число, формула может вывести предупреждение или ноль, вместо того чтобы прервать вычисления во всей колонке. Это особенно актуально для данных, импортируемых из внешних источников или 1С.

⚠️ Внимание: Текстовое представление чисел (например, "100" с ведущим апострофом) при сравнении может вести себя непредсказуемо. Всегда проверяйте формат ячеек перед запуском логических функций.

Еще один важный аспект — обработка пустых ячеек. Пустая ячейка при сравнении часто приравнивается к нулю. Если ваше условие гласит «если больше 0», то пустая ячейка не пройдет проверку, что логично. Но если условие «если больше или равно 0», пустая ячейка будет оценена как истинная, что может исказить статистику. Для избежания этого можно добавить проверку на пустоту: =ЕСЛИ(A1=""; ""; ЕСЛИ(A1>0; "Есть"; "Нет")).

Вложенные условия и множественные критерии

Часто одного условия «больше» бывает недостаточно. Бизнес-логика может требовать проверки нескольких диапазонов одновременно. Например, нужно categorize клиентов: если продажи больше 1 млн — «Золотой», если больше 500 тыс, но меньше 1 млн — «Серебряный», иначе — «Бронзовый». Для этого используется вложенность функций или, в новых версиях Excel, функция ЕСЛИМН.

Классическая вложенность выглядит как матрешка, где внутри аргумента «значение если истина» или «значение если ложь» прячется новая функция ЕСЛИ. Порядок вложения критически важен: сначала проверяются самые высокие пороги. Если вы начнете с проверки «больше 500», то число 1 200 000 тоже пройдет этот тест, и программа не дойдет до проверки на «Золотой» статус, если логика не выстроена правильно.

=ЕСЛИ(A1>1000000; "Золотой"; ЕСЛИ(A1>500000; "Серебряный"; "Бронзовый"))

Альтернативой вложению является использование логических функций И и ИЛИ. Функция И требует выполнения всех условий одновременно. Например, бонус начисляется, если продажи больше плана И количество дней работы больше 20. Функция ИЛИ сработает, если выполнится хотя бы одно из условий. Комбинирование этих инструментов дает полную свободу в построении алгоритмов любой сложности.

Секрет эффективной вложенности

При построении сложных вложенных формул всегда начинайте проверку с самого узкого или самого высокого диапазона значений. Это предотвращает ситуации, когда условие «отсекается» на первом же шаге, не доходя до более специфичных проверок.

Визуализация результатов с помощью форматирования

Сухие цифры и тексты «Да/Нет» не всегда удобны для восприятия. Excel предлагает мощный инструмент «Условное форматирование», который работает по тем же логическим принципам, что и формула ЕСЛИ, но меняет внешний вид ячейки. Вы можете сделать так, чтобы все значения, которые больше заданного порога, автоматически окрашивались в зеленый цвет, а меньшие — в красный.

Для настройки этого инструмента не обязательно писать сложные формулы вручную. В меню «Главная» -> «Условное форматирование» -> «Правила выделения ячеек» -> «Больше...» можно задать порог за пару кликов. Однако, использование формулы в правилах форматирования дает больше гибкости. Вы можете сравнивать значение ячейки не с константой, а с результатом вычислений в другой части таблицы.

Цветовая кодировка позволяет мгновенно считывать состояние дел. Менеджер, открывший отчет, сразу видит «горящие» красным показатели, требующие вмешательства. Это превращает статичную таблицу в динамическую панель управления (dashboard). Сочетание логических формул в ячейках и условного форматирования создает максимально информативное пространство для анализа.

Часто задаваемые вопросы (FAQ)

Можно ли использовать формулу ЕСЛИ с текстовыми данными?

Да, функция универсальна. Вы можете проверять, равно ли текстовое значение определенному слову, или использовать операторы сравнения для алфавитного порядка. Главное — не забывать заключать текст в кавычки внутри формулы.

Почему формула возвращает ЛОЖЬ, хотя число явно больше?

Чаще всего причина кроется в формате ячейки. Число может быть сохранено как текст (часто бывает при выгрузке из баз данных). Проверьте, выровнено ли число по правому краю (как положено числам) или по левому (как текст). Преобразуйте текст в число через меню «Данные» -> «Текст по столбцам».

Какой максимальный уровень вложенности функций ЕСЛИ поддерживается?

В современных версиях Excel (начиная с 2016 и Office 365) допускается до 64 уровней вложенности. Однако, если вам требуется более 3-4 уровней, рекомендуется использовать функцию ВПР, ПРОСМОТРX или ЕСЛИМН для оптимизации и читаемости файла.

Как игнорировать пустые ячейки при сравнении?

Добавьте проверку на пустоту в начало формулы: =ЕСЛИ(A1=""; ""; ЕСЛИ(A1>100; "Много"; "Мало")). Это предотвратит обработку пустоты как нуля, что может быть важно для статистики.

Работает ли эта логика в Google Таблицах?

Да, синтаксис функции ЕСЛИ и логических операторов в Google Sheets практически идентичен Excel. Вы можете смело переносить эти формулы между программами, единственное отличие может быть в разделителях аргументов (запятая против точки с запятой) в зависимости от настроек региона.